What the company does PDD Holdings Inc. operates two global e-commerce platforms: Pinduoduo, a social commerce marketplace in China, and Temu, a cross-border discount retail platform. The group monetizes via transaction fees, advertising, and logistics services, targeting value-conscious consumers and merchants.

Key financials PDD’s profitability is strong: gross margin 56%, operating margin 18.4%, net margin 21.6%, and ROE 25.4%. Revenue grew 11% year-over-year, though EPS fell 14.9%. The balance sheet is pristine: debt/equity 0.01, net cash/EBITDA –4.44, and current ratio 2.54.

Stock health Momentum is weak: –10.47% over 3 months, –14.95% over 6 months, and –24.24% over 12 months. RSI(14) is 57.70, indicating neutral technicals. Strength score is 95.1, but momentum is just 18.6, highlighting valuation support with weak price action.

Price vs fair value The stock trades at a discount to both our fair-value estimate and analyst target. - Price is at a discount of 75.90% versus our fair-value estimate of 153.85 - Price is at a discount of 33.28% versus the 12-month target of 116.54 (analyst count 34.0) - Valuation percentile is 91.3/100, with Fwd P/E 8.53 and EV/EBITDA 3.48 - Recent headline notes PDD ADR outperforming the market (Zacks)

Looking forward Forward PEG of 0.99 and FCF yield of 57.6% suggest deep value, but growth is flagging (Growth score 32.0). Investors weigh Temu’s cross-border expansion against Pinduoduo’s China slowdown. Analysts see room for rerating if monetization improves.
